Post by Raichase »

You have to "fund" a lumber mill (by hand or by using the scenario deitor). It cuts down nearby trees and produces wood - the more trees the more wood. Prob is when it runs out of trees you need to plant more. This is offset by the extreme payment levels you get from wood if its done fast enough ( i took it by SHIP and got 100,000+ each year.
